Transaction 32eaa54577b2da0ef8af63e1223c4e1976030c053a0948e7b4dec6c708c1fc0b

1 Input
2 Outputs
  • 32eaa54577b2da0ef8af63e1223c4e1976030c053a0948e7b4dec6c708c1fc0b:0
  • value  994405
    address  1Ff77Msm8oYXoDA4ew4X5MUNePemFudgWe
  • 32eaa54577b2da0ef8af63e1223c4e1976030c053a0948e7b4dec6c708c1fc0b:1
  • value  3929301
    address  1DirfYa9mPEsnp6bCtCtajtjixezdZWTCx